摘要

The paper presents a QoS multicast routing algorithm bassed on Clonal Selection and Artificial Fish Swarm algorithms (CSA-AFSA). The hybrid algorithms reasonably use the superiorities of both algorithms and try to overcome their inherent drawbacks. An improved initialization method is used to make sure each individual in initial population is a reasonable multicast tree without loops. The simulation carried out with different network scale. For performance comparison, Ant Colony Optimization (ACO) algorithm and Genetic Algorithm (GA) also been tested. The results have demonstrated the hybrid algorithm has high speed of convergence and searching capability to solve QoS multicast routing effectively.
